After President Donald Trump announced plans to relocate U.S. Space Command’s headquarters from Colorado Springs to Alabama, members of the Centennial State’s congressional delegation swiftly denounced the decision — including its Republicans.
A joint statement from Colorado Senators John Hickenlooper and Michael Bennet along with the eight U.S. House members from Colorado stated, “Colorado Springs is the appropriate home for U.S. Space Command, and we will take the necessary action to keep it there.”
